We need to copy input to @auxfp to implement command line option -2,
and pass it to save_input() to enable protection against a rogue
server exploiting redirection and execute. We currently do this right
when input enters the ring buffer, in recv_input().
Calling save_input() before sending input to the server is sloppy: it
can make the client accept "future" redirections and executes.
Delay save_input() until after input is sent. For simplicity, delay
copying to @auxfp as well.
This is actually pretty close to how things worked before commit
8b7d0b9 (v4.3.11).
